单位层级算法bug解决
This commit is contained in:
@@ -113,6 +113,11 @@ public class RStatHarmonicServiceImpl implements RStatHarmonicService {
|
|||||||
List<ROperatingMonitorDPO> rOperatingMonitorDPOS = rOperatingMonitorDMapper.selectList(rOperatingMonitorDPOQueryWrapper);
|
List<ROperatingMonitorDPO> rOperatingMonitorDPOS = rOperatingMonitorDMapper.selectList(rOperatingMonitorDPOQueryWrapper);
|
||||||
List<String> effLineIds = rOperatingMonitorDPOS.stream().map(ROperatingMonitorDPO::getMeasurementPointId).distinct().collect(Collectors.toList());
|
List<String> effLineIds = rOperatingMonitorDPOS.stream().map(ROperatingMonitorDPO::getMeasurementPointId).distinct().collect(Collectors.toList());
|
||||||
|
|
||||||
|
|
||||||
|
if(CollectionUtil.isEmpty(effLineIds)){
|
||||||
|
return;
|
||||||
|
}
|
||||||
|
|
||||||
queryWrapper.clear();
|
queryWrapper.clear();
|
||||||
queryWrapper.select("is_freq","is_v_dev","is_v","is_i","is_unbalance","is_i_neg").
|
queryWrapper.select("is_freq","is_v_dev","is_v","is_i","is_unbalance","is_i_neg").
|
||||||
in("measurement_point_id",effLineIds).
|
in("measurement_point_id",effLineIds).
|
||||||
|
|||||||
Reference in New Issue
Block a user